At the annual Innovation Awards, AI-based startup “Hank” received recognition as the Sustainability Innovation of the year.  Hank is saving building owners over 30% of their energy bills by tuning their existing energy management systems through close monitoring and machine learning.  Hank also has closed a small investment round to give them some more runway to build a customer base. They are already generating revenue from a small number of early customers.

Also recognized for sustainability innovations were RePurpose Energy with its second-life EV battery-based solar energy storage systems and Sustainable Technology with its clever “Facet” rooftop mounts for solar PV panels.
